Hey Priya,

Welcome to the Hooksmith rotation! Quick thing before your first shift: webhook deliveries retry up to 6 times with exponential backoff, then land in the dead-letter queue. Don't manually replay anything until you've checked the consumer's idempotency flag — some partners double-charge otherwise. Full retry semantics and the replay checklist are written up here.

operations page: https://jira.lumiclabs.internal/pages/display/projects/af69ce92

Ticket: Unlock migration vault for Ironvine ORM refactor

New team members: the legacy Ironvine ORM layer is being replaced module by module, and the schema snapshots needed for safe refactoring sit in a locked vault nobody has opened since the last owner left. We recovered the credentials from escrow this week. The passphrase follows below.

unlock words, kajog-yawip: istwyn-casath-aldok

For sales leads. Harkwell, the internal quoting tool rebuild, is eight weeks behind. Cause: integration issues with the Pellery billing backend and two engineer departures. Revised delivery: end of next quarter. Impact: continue using the legacy Quotemark workflow; no customer-facing changes. Do not promise Harkwell features in active deals. Mira Tollsen will circulate interim workarounds. Escalations go through the Delivery Office, not project staff. A confidential note on related business plans appears below.

management briefing: Project Ulavan slips by two quarters because of the staffing delay.